Age doesn't come into it. The rules are changing. This is not the LEZ rules of a couple of years ago but new rules coming into force in jan 2012.

Looking at this website, it seems we will be affected from jan 2012 as we weigh over 1.25 tonnes. (What's a fourtrak - 1.7?)

The get-out is if it says bodytype is "car" on our logbooks....I'll check when I get home.

http://www.tfl.gov.uk/roadusers/lez/17700.aspx#tkt-tab-panel-2

if you want a real laugh, scroll down to the bottom and read the case studies - Toyota Hilux Surf, Transit horsebox and an old LandRover, none of them are LEZ-compliant and the cost of fitting approved filters to them was between £1500-2500 each!!!

The daily fine is £100.

i thought it only applied to

i thought it only applied to diesel commercials?

ive seen some discussions on landrover forums.... discos with rear windows are exempt... defender diesels get hammered unless its a station wagon AND it was registered as an estate car... aparently a lot wernt so get clobbered.... so a defender diesel doing 30mpg gets hit while a v8 petrol on 12mpg dont

so fourtrak should be ok unless its a fieldman

and its pretty much anywhere inside the m25
